Each short story focuses on particular words that contain the same phoneme (sound.) Once the story has been read, students can then use the words to illustrate a scene from the story on the blank template provided. Four templates in all, they can be stapled together to make a booklet.
During the course of a year, students actually design their own library of phonemes and stories that will make learning fun. Teachers can also make a class library set and students can refer to the short stories to consolidate the use of the phoneme in certain words during silent reading time.
